Getting a longer-term finance will certainly trigger you to spend extra in passion, making the automobile extra pricey to fund over time. Long payment durations can also make it more difficult to function toward various other economic goals or purchase a different auto if your scenarios alter especially if you still owe a lot of cash on your financing.


Doing your research, looking around and getting preapproved can aid you get the most effective offer on a brand-new automobile. Also if a supplier asks in advance, don't discuss your trade-in or your wish to get a vehicle loan


If you bargain the price down to $22,000 initially, and then state your trade-in, you could end up getting a rate under the dealership's reduced end of $20,000. Numerous automobile salespeople have established sales objectives for completion of monthly and quarter. Plan your check out to the dealership close to these schedule times, and you may get a much better bargain or extra cost savings if they still require to reach their allocation.


After you've worked out the final automobile cost, ask the dealership concerning any offers or programs you get approved for or mention any kind of you found online to bring the rate down a lot more. Speaking of stating the best things, do not tell the supplier what regular monthly settlement you're trying to find. If you desire the most effective offer, begin negotiations by asking the dealership what the out-the-door rate is.

FYI: The sticker price isn't the total rate of the car it's simply the supplier's recommended retail rate (MSRP). Keep in mind those taxes and fees we claimed you'll need to pay when buying an auto? Those are included (in addition to the MSRP) in what's called the out-the-door cost - mazda3 dealer near me. Why bargain based on the out-the-door rate? Dealerships can expand funding settlement terms to strike your target monthly payment while not decreasing the out-the-door cost, and you'll finish up paying more interest in the long run.


Both you and the dealership are qualified to a reasonable deal but you'll likely wind up paying a little bit greater than you want and the dealer will likely get a little less than they want. Always start arrangements by asking what the out-the-door rate is and go from there. If the dealer isn't going low enough, you might have the ability to discuss some specific items to get closer to your preferred rate.

Just since you have actually negotiated a deal does not suggest you're home-free. You'll likely be used add-on options, like expensive modern technology packages, interior upgrades, extended service warranties, gap insurance coverage and various other protection strategies. Ask yourself if the add-on is something you genuinely require prior to concurring, as most of these offers can be included at a later date if you select.

The wholesale cost is what dealers pay for used cars at public auction. Wholesale price drops commonly precede list price visit 6 to 8 weeks. A rate decline is always a good indicator for used car shoppers. Yet before you start doing the happy-car-shopper dancing, maintain in mind the marketplace is still tough.


Passion rates, typically greater for used vehicle finances than new automobile lendings, are steadily intensifying. In other words, if you finance a previously owned automobile, the regular monthly settlements will be higher now than a year ago.

A private vendor doesn't have to cover the overhead costs a dealer produces. A supplier is really a middleman in the transaction, developing the needed profit by inflating the purchase cost when marketing the vehicle. At the end of the day, the peer-to-peer bargain will just be as great as the customer's negotiating skills.


Theoretically, a private seller's original asking cost will certainly be lower than a car dealership's cost for the factors made a list of above. By the time the buyer and seller reach the negotiating stage, the private vendor has spent a lot of time in offering you an automobile.
